ARTICLE: "z-algorithm" "Z algorithm"
|
||||
{ $heading "Definition" }
|
||||
"Given the sequence " { $snippet "S" } " and the index "
|
||||
{ $snippet "i" } ", let " { $snippet "i" } "-th Z value of "
|
||||
{ $snippet "S" } " be the length of the longest subsequence of "
|
||||
{ $snippet "S" } " that starts at " { $snippet "i" }
|
||||
" and matches the prefix of " { $snippet "S" } "."
|
||||
|
||||
{ $heading "Example" }
|
||||
"Here is an example for string " { $snippet "\"abababaca\"" } ":"
|
||||
{ $table
|
||||
{ { $snippet "i:" } "0" "1" "2" "3" "4" "5" "6" "7" "8" }
|
||||
{ { $snippet "S:" } "a" "b" "a" "b" "a" "b" "a" "c" "a" }
|
||||
{ { $snippet "Z:" } "9" "0" "5" "0" "3" "0" "1" "0" "1" }
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
{ $heading "Summary" }
|
||||
"The " { $vocab-link "z-algorithm" }
|
||||
" vocabulary implements algorithm for finding all Z values for sequence "
|
||||
{ $snippet "S" }
|
||||
" in linear time. In contrast to naive approach which takes "
|
||||
{ $snippet "Θ(n^2)" } " time."
|
||||
;
